Cha-ching! Selena Gomez, the most followed celebrity on Instagram, has the potential to make an unfathomable amount of money for a single sponsored post.

Related: PHOTOS: See Selena Gomez's Sexiest Styles Through the Years

According to data measurement company D’Marie Analytics, 23-year-old Gomez is the most influential star on the social media platform. Sitting atop a list that includes other notable names such as Taylor Swift, Beyoncé and Rihanna, the “Kill Em With Kindness” singer is worth a whopping $550,000 when the messaging for a particular brand or product is shared across her Instagram, Facebook and Twitter pages. She has nearly 200 million followers among the three platforms.

AdWeek reports that Gomez’s online value has dramatically increased since December 2015, when D’Marie estimated that the Disney Channel alum would be able to charge approximately $230,000 for a sponsored post.

D’Marie Group CEO Frank Spadafora spoke with AdWeek about the formula used to determine the pop star’s high price tag.

“The rate-per-post is her ‘ad equivalent’ value per post across Facebook, Twitter and Instagram. This may be different than how much she is actually getting paid when participating in social media campaigns. That is up to negotiations between her agents and the brands,” he explained. “This valuation is based on D’Marie’s algorithm which measures 56 metrics including followers, post frequency, engagement, quality of post, click-through and potential to create sales conversions from her social content.”

Spadafora noted that Gomez — who boasts 90.5 million Instagram followers and has previously partnered with brands such as Coca-Cola and Pantene — chooses not to inundate fans’ newsfeeds with sponsored content.

“It’s interesting that the statistically most influential person on social media is engaged in noticeably less campaigns than other celebrities,”he told AdWeek. “Personally, I think it’s because she’s being smart and she’s aware that oversaturating her social feeds with sponsored content could negatively impact the relationship she has with her audience.”

As previously reported, Gomez recently took the crown for the most-liked Instagram photo. The winning snapshot — which has garnered 4.6 million double-taps and counting, not to mention more than 122,000 comments since it was posted on June 25 — features the brunette beauty dressed in a bright red ribbed tank top paired with matching crimson nails and bombshell curls. She’s sipping from a classic Coke bottle, which reads, “You’re the spark,” a line from her track “Me & the Rhythm.”

“when your lyrics are on the bottle 😛,” she appropriately captioned the ’gram.

Before Gomez shot straight to the top to claim Instagram’s most-liked image, her ex-boyfriend Justin Bieber held the peak position thanks to a throwback photo featuring the “Hands to Myself” songstress. In the pic — which JB posted in March and which received more than 3.7 million likes — the former couple share a smooch while embracing in the ocean. It also has more than a million comments.

Earlier this month, the Spring Breakers actress opened up about her massive online following in an interview with The Hollywood Reporter.

“It comes in a moment when I capture something happening, and I go, ‘Oh, that would be great for Instagram; I should post it,'” she told THR for a cover story about social media. “I know it’s boring, but that’s genuinely what I do.”

She continued, “It wasn’t my goal to be the most-followed person,” but added, “It’s my favorite social platform.”
